gnus-art.el (gnus-button-alist): Also support quotes 'like this'
[gnus] / lisp / registry.el
index c8d7d85..44c3358 100644 (file)
@@ -361,11 +361,12 @@ from the front of the list are deleted first.
 
 Returns the number of deleted entries."
   (let ((size (registry-size db))
-       (target-size (- (oref db max-size)
-                       (* (oref db max-size)
-                          (oref db prune-factor))))
+       (target-size
+        (floor (- (oref db max-size)
+                  (* (oref db max-size)
+                     (oref db prune-factor)))))
        candidates)
-    (if (> size (oref db max-size))
+    (if (registry-full db)
        (progn
          (setq candidates
                (registry-collect-prune-candidates